The first group of photos captured by the NASA Webb Telescope shows the Southern Ring Nebula in near-infrared light, released from Goddard Space Flight Center July 12, 2022 in Greenbelt, Maryland. This scene was created by a white dwarf star - the remains of a star like our Sun after it shed its outer layers and stopped burning fuel though nuclear fusion. Those outer layers now form the ejected shells all along this view. Credit: NASA/JPL-Caltech/NASA, ESA, CSA, STScI/Alamy Live News
